Transaction 8d816d90cc11b51c6e5468f9ff8c27bfc5987849b68d74f6a58a0e85dfc0b838

1 Input
2 Outputs
  • 8d816d90cc11b51c6e5468f9ff8c27bfc5987849b68d74f6a58a0e85dfc0b838:0
  • value  169992710
    address  18oFTP5M4ReDMKJ1DiZyJBkSPHRV8v3RE9
  • 8d816d90cc11b51c6e5468f9ff8c27bfc5987849b68d74f6a58a0e85dfc0b838:1
  • value  30000000
    address  39aDmFT8USzw14pWeuX7sj8cbXZJQiM5ih